A Jan. 31 arson fire destroyed two containers at a Mililani business, causing $50K in damage.
A fire that destroyed two storage containers at a Mililani business on January 31, 2026, was intentionally set, police say, with estimated damages of $50,000.
The blaze, reported at 5:30 a.m., was investigated by Honolulu Fire Department and police, who are seeking leads in the arson case.
No suspect has been identified.
Meanwhile, coastal flooding warnings remain in effect across Hawaii through Monday due to elevated tides and large surf, causing minor flooding and beach erosion, especially during peak high tides.
Residents are advised to avoid flooded areas and secure property.
